Planning a trip from India to Italy can be exciting but also a bit overwhelming. You might wonder about the best ways to travel, what documents you need, and how to make your journey smooth. I’m here to guide you through the entire process, so you can focus on enjoying your Italian adventure.
Whether you’re visiting Italy for tourism, business, or study, this guide will help you understand everything from booking flights to getting your visa. Let’s explore how you can make your trip from India to Italy hassle-free and enjoyable.
Flying is the most common and practical way to travel from India to Italy. Several airlines operate flights connecting major Indian cities to Italian airports.
To enter Italy, Indian citizens need a Schengen visa since Italy is part of the Schengen Area. The visa application process requires careful preparation.
Travel insurance is mandatory for a Schengen visa and highly recommended for your safety.
Before traveling, consult your doctor about vaccinations and health advice for Italy.
Italy uses the Euro (€). It’s best to prepare your finances before you travel.

The best time is during the shoulder seasons (April to June and September to October) when flights are cheaper and the weather is pleasant.
Visa processing usually takes about 15 calendar days but can vary depending on the season and your application.
You need an International Driving Permit (IDP) along with your Indian license to drive legally in Italy.
Yes, Air India offers direct flights from Delhi to Rome, but most other airlines have one or two stops.
Yes, travel insurance covering at least €30,000 for medical emergencies is mandatory for a Schengen visa.
